Crunch decision on future of NHS walk-in centre could be delayed
NHS bosses are considering shutting down the Norwich Walk-in Centre in Rouen Road as part of a host of cost-cutting measures.
Health leaders had planned to make a decision on its future in June, with changes set to see the centre either close or have its opening hours slashed to just four hours a day.
But this could now be pushed back due to the resignations of three councillors triggering an upcoming by-election.
